Description

Set against the sapphire backdrop of the Atlantic Ocean, Castle Hill on the Crane Estate in Ipswich, Massachusetts, is today the only known designed landscape of its size and kind still in existence in North America. This beautifully illustrated and practical guide provides the history and context of the stunning country estate of plumbing magnate Richard T. Crane, Jr. and his family, which draws many thousands of visitors each year. It includes the house built by architect David Adler in 1928, with period furnishings, and marvellous natural landscapes and extensive gardens designed by some of the century’s most notable landscape architects.
